What is Webster Financial Corporation's healthcare financial services — compensation and benefits?
Webster Financial Corporation (WBS) reported healthcare financial services — compensation and benefits of $25.27M in Q1 2026.
How has Webster Financial Corporation's healthcare financial services — compensation and benefits changed year-over-year?
Webster Financial Corporation's healthcare financial services — compensation and benefits increased by 8.3% year-over-year, from $23.34M to $25.27M.
What is the long-term trend for Webster Financial Corporation's healthcare financial services — compensation and benefits?
Over 3 years (2022 to 2025), Webster Financial Corporation's healthcare financial services — compensation and benefits has grown at a 9.2% compound annual growth rate (CAGR), from $73.76M to $96M.
